The radius of the circle above is 17 cm. What is the circumference of the circle? (Use pi = 3.14.)
Neko [114]

Answer:

D. 106.76 cm

Step-by-step explanation:

We want to find the circumference of the circle

The formula is

C=2 * pi *r

  = 2 * (3.14) * 17

   = 34*3.14

   = 106.76 cm
